Typical Types of Exterior Door Damage


Comprehending the kinds of damage that can affect exterior doors is the primary step in planning repairs. Here's a list of typical concerns house owners might come across:

Type of Damage

Description

Contorting

Doors may warp due to moisture or temperature changes, causing misalignment.

Cracks and Splits

Wood doors are especially prone to splitting or splitting with age.

Rot

Typically seen in wooden doors exposed to moisture, this can weaken the door structure.

Misalignment

Doors might become misaligned with their frames, preventing correct opening and closing.

Surface Damage

Scratches, damages, and peeling paint can mar the look of exterior doors.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)


Q1: How typically should I examine my exterior doors?

A: It is suggested to examine exterior doors at least when a year, trying to find indications of damage, wear, or modifications in fit.

Q2: Can I paint my exterior door without sanding?

A: While you can paint without sanding, for the best finish, it is suggested to sand the surface to make sure much better adhesion.

Q3: What are the signs that I need to change my exterior door?

A: Signs consist of extensive rot, severe warping, problem opening or closing the door, and visible fractures or splits that can not be fixed.

Q4: How do I know if my door's weather removing requirements to be replaced?

A: If you see drafts, increased energy costs, or noticeable wear and tear, it's time to replace the weather stripping.

Q5: Is it better to repair or replace my exterior door?

A: If the damage is superficial or minimal to small issues, repairs can be enough. Nevertheless, for structural damage or significant wear, replacement might be the finest long-lasting option.
